WebDec 4, 2024 · The word 'Rasul' (رسول) is derived from 'Risalat' (رسالة). 'Risalat' means to send; and 'Rasul' means one who is sent. Thus the word 'Rasul' means 'one who is sent from Allah.’. According to Muslim terminology. 'Nabi' means 'A man sent directly by God to the mankind to lead them to right path.’. The word 'man' excludes the angels ... WebJan 7, 2016 · The word niv in this verse in Isaiah means something like the “outgrowth of” or “something that flows from.” From his further comments, we see that Rashi views a navi as one who expresses words of reproach to the people. Rashbam (comm. to Gen 20:7) also connects navi with niv.
